New Flickr Guidelines

FlickrHas anyone noticed that flickr has posted new user guidelines? flickr has spelled out some strict DOs and DONTs for its users and they don’t look good for some people. Some of the main DONTs go like this, Don’t “Use your account to host web graphics like logos and banners.” Don’t “Sell stuff (including yourself).” Don’t “Upload anything that isn’t yours.” Do you think they are serious? One of the last lines in the news release goes like this “Plainly speaking, if you don’t want to abide by our TOS and these Guidelines, don’t let the door hit you on your way out!”
